WAGO DIN Rail Power Supply, 24V DC Output Voltage, 120W Power Rating - 787 Series - 787-722


When efficiency is a top priority, surge ahead with this DIN rail power supply from WAGO. It converts input voltages between 85 and 264V AC or between 90 and 373V DC into a steady output voltage of 24V DC for use with low-voltage equipment. It’s a cinch to install by clipping directly onto a DIN rail. Natural convection cooling prevents the power supply from overheating when it's horizontally mounted, keeping you and your equipment safe.

Features & Benefits


• Short circuit protection kicks in automatically in the event of a fault to protect your machinery from damage
• Efficiency of 86% means little energy is wasted as heat
• LED indicator shows its operating status at a glance
• IP20 rating indicates it’s finger-safe and protected against objects over 12mm in size
• Performs reliably in challenging environments, thanks to a broad operating temperature range between -10°C and +60°C

Applications


• Process control
• Factory automation
• Power distribution

What's the power rating of this DIN rail power supply?


It has a power rating of 120W, making it just the thing for use in heavy-duty systems.
